Output 84f5f5db5fbecbc81df79fbf2091c6e659c747e7e1c78cbbe2c6f660c6444284:69
- value
- 39366
- script pubkey
- OP_0 OP_PUSHBYTES_20 8abb8d77bf7f05e3bdf2d818e9baa755357f6165
- address
- tb1q32ac6aal0uz7800jmqvwnw48256h7ct96zj7eg
- transaction
- 84f5f5db5fbecbc81df79fbf2091c6e659c747e7e1c78cbbe2c6f660c6444284
- confirmations
- 18337
- spent
- true